Drawbridge Operation Regulations; Snake River, Burbank, WA
AGENCY: Coast Guard, DHS.
ACTION: Notice of temporary deviation from regulations.
-----------------------------------------------------------------------
SUMMARY: The Commander, Thirteenth Coast Guard District, has issued a
temporary deviation from the regulation governing the operation of the
Burlington Northern Santa Fe Railroad Drawbridge across the Snake
River, mile 1.5, at Burbank, Washington. This deviation allows the
vertical lift span to be temporarily closed during two periods while
wire ropes are replaced. The deviation is necessary to facilitate this
essential maintenance.
DATES: This deviation is effective from 8 a.m. March 8 through 5 p.m.
March 12, 2004, and from 8 a.m. March 15 through 5 p.m. March 16, 2004.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The Burlington Northern Santa Fe Railroad
(BNSF) requested this deviation from normal operations to facilitate
the replacement of wire ropes on the lift span and its supporting
towers. This project is occurring during the annual lock maintenance
closure on the Snake River. During lock closure commercial traffic will
be much reduced so that few, if any, vessels will be hindered by this
bridge maintenance project. Currently, this drawbridge is maintained in
the open position except for the passage of trains.
In accordance with 33 CFR 117.35(c), this work will be performed
with all due speed in order to return the bridge to normal operation as
soon as possible. This deviation from the operating regulations is
authorized under 33 CFR 117.35.
